Discover Medieval Tuscany with SRISA!

Siena is one of Italy’s best-preserved medieval cities, renowned for its remarkable architecture, artistic heritage, and enduring civic traditions. Once a powerful independent republic, the city flourished throughout the Middle Ages, leaving behind a historic center that is now recognized as a UNESCO World Heritage Site.

During the guided walking tour, you’ll explore Siena’s winding cobblestone streets and lively piazzas while discovering landmarks such as the Piazza del Campo, the elegant Palazzo Pubblico, the soaring Torre del Mangia, and the magnificent Duomo di Siena. The city is also home to the world-famous Palio di Siena, the historic horse race held twice each summer in Piazza del Campo, a tradition that has shaped Sienese identity for centuries.

Following the tour, you’ll have free time to experience the city at your own pace and take in the atmosphere of one of Tuscany’s most distinctive cities.
